To complete a bachelor’s at ASU Tempe, information technology students accumulate a median of $32,375 in student loans. This is above $22,239, the typical median for all majors at ASU Tempe.
Average full-time tuition and fees are listed in the table below.
| In State | Out of State | |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$10,710 | $32,394 |
| Fees | $745 | $745 |

In the most recent graduating class, 95% of information technology bachelor’s degrees went to men and 5% went to women.
The majority of information technology bachelor’s degree graduates at ASU Tempe were White. Roughly 48%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Arizona State University Campus Immersion with a bachelor’s in information technology.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 7 |
| Black or African American | 4 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 9 |
| White | 31 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 11 |
| Other Races | 3 |
